找回密码
 立即注册
首页 业界区 业界 DeepSeek + Mermaid:零代码玩转专业流程图

DeepSeek + Mermaid:零代码玩转专业流程图

判涔 2025-6-9 15:15:21
一、工具组合超能力解析

1.png

黄金组合优势:


  • 语言到图表的直接转换 - 用中文描述即可生成专业图表
  • 动态修正能力 - 实时调整描述立即更新图表
  • 企业级复杂度支持 - 轻松处理多层级流程
  • 零安装成本 - 纯Web环境运行
二、Mermaid核心语法速成

1. 流程图基础结构

描述词:
"创建一个横向流程图,包含开始节点、3个并行处理步骤、决策分支和结束节点"
DeepSeek生成:
  1. graph LR
  2.     A[开始] --> B{并行任务}
  3.     B --> C[步骤1]
  4.     B --> D[步骤2]
  5.     B --> E[步骤3]
  6.     C --> F{质量检查}
  7.     D --> F
  8.     E --> F
  9.     F -->|通过| G[结束]
  10.     F -->|不通过| B
复制代码
2.png

2. 时序图交互

描述词:
"生成用户登录系统的时序图,包含客户端、认证服务、数据库的三方交互"
DeepSeek生成:
  1. sequenceDiagram
  2.     participant 用户
  3.     participant 客户端
  4.     participant 认证服务
  5.     participant 数据库
  6.    
  7.     用户->>客户端: 输入账号密码
  8.     客户端->>认证服务: 发送认证请求
  9.     认证服务->>数据库: 查询用户凭证
  10.     数据库-->>认证服务: 返回验证结果
  11.     认证服务-->>客户端: 生成访问令牌
  12.     客户端-->>用户: 显示欢迎页面
复制代码
3.png

3. 甘特图项目管理

描述词:
"创建产品开发甘特图,包含需求分析(5天)、UI设计(7天)、开发(14天)、测试(5天)阶段,测试在开发完成后开始"
DeepSeek生成:
  1. gantt
  2.     title 产品开发计划
  3.     dateFormat  YYYY-MM-DD
  4.     section 阶段
  5.     需求分析     :a1, 2023-08-01, 5d
  6.     UI设计       :a2, after a1, 7d
  7.     开发         :a3, after a2, 14d
  8.     测试         :a4, after a3, 5d
复制代码
4.png

三、企业级应用实战案例

案例1:采购审批流程

描述词:
"垂直流程图:采购申请->部门审批->金额>5000转财务总监->签订合同->付款,包含回退路径"
DeepSeek生成:
  1. graph TD
  2.     A[采购申请] --> B{部门审批}
  3.     B -->|通过| C{金额>5000?}
  4.     C -->|是| D[财务总监审批]
  5.     C -->|否| E[签订合同]
  6.     D -->|通过| E
  7.     D -->|拒绝| A
  8.     E --> F[财务付款]
  9.     B -->|拒绝| G[修改申请]
  10.     G --> A
复制代码
5.png
案例2:微服务架构图

描述词:
"生成电商系统架构图:用户服务、订单服务、支付服务、库存服务,用不同颜色表示,显示API网关入口"
DeepSeek生成:
  1. graph TB
  2.     subgraph 电商系统
  3.         direction TB
  4.         GW[API网关] --> US[用户服务]
  5.         GW --> OS[订单服务]
  6.         GW --> PS[支付服务]
  7.         GW --> IS[库存服务]
  8.         
  9.         OS --> PS
  10.         OS --> IS
  11.     end
  12.    
  13.     classDef microservice fill:#f9f,stroke:#333;
  14.     class US,OS,PS,IS microservice;
复制代码
6.png
案例3:故障排查决策树

描述词:
"创建网络故障诊断决策树:从'无法上网'开始,包含Ping测试、DNS检查、路由追踪等诊断节点"
DeepSeek生成:
  1. graph TD
  2.     Start[无法上网] --> Step1{能Ping通网关?}
  3.     Step1 -->|是| Step2{DNS解析正常?}
  4.     Step1 -->|否| Step3[检查网线/IP配置]
  5.     Step2 -->|是| Step4{目标服务端口通?}
  6.     Step2 -->|否| Step5[更换DNS服务器]
  7.     Step4 -->|是| Step6[检查应用状态]
  8.     Step4 -->|否| Step7[检查防火墙规则]
复制代码
7.png
四、高阶技巧:让图表会说话

1. 动态交互增强

8.png

2. 企业配色方案

描述词:
"使用公司VI色:主色#2A5CAA,辅助色#F0B323,错误状态用#E74C3C"
DeepSeek生成:
  1. graph LR
  2.     classDef primary fill:#2A5CAA,color:white;
  3.     classDef secondary fill:#F0B323;
  4.     classDef error fill:#E74C3C,color:white;
  5.    
  6.     A[开始]:::primary --> B[处理]:::secondary
  7.     B --> C{检查}
  8.     C -->|通过| D[完成]:::primary
  9.     C -->|失败| E[错误]:::error
复制代码
9.png

3. 跨图表链接

描述词:
"创建两个关联流程图,点击'详细设计'跳转到子流程图"
DeepSeek生成:
  1. graph TB
  2.     A[需求分析] --> B[系统设计]
  3.     B --> C[详细设计]
  4.     click C "diagram2.html" _blank
复制代码
五、企业落地实施路线

部署架构:

10.png

培训计划:


  • 基础语法训练
  • 业务场景实践
  • 复杂系统建模
六、效能对比报告

指标传统方式DeepSeek+Mermaid提升率图表创建时间45分钟3分钟1500%修改迭代成本高极低∞跨部门理解度60%95%58%版本一致性易出错100%一致-
某500强企业实测:IT部门流程图制作工时从每月1200小时降至150小时
立即行动指南:


  • 打开DeepSeek聊天窗口
  • 输入:
  1. 请生成Mermaid代码:  
  2. [在此粘贴你的流程图描述]  
复制代码

  • 复制生成的代码到支持Mermaid的平台:

    • VS Code(安装Mermaid插件)
    • GitHub/GitLab Markdown
    • Mermaid Live Editor(在线编辑器)

  • Mermaid 语法文档
最佳实践:企业可部署私有化DeepSeek服务+内部Mermaid渲染平台,实现全自动文档生产流水线

来源:程序园用户自行投稿发布,如果侵权,请联系站长删除
免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!
您需要登录后才可以回帖 登录 | 立即注册